Malawi: Former President Peter Mutharika has accused President Lazarus Chakwera of "over-travelling," calling it insensitive and a waste of public funds, writes Rose Milanzi, Lilongwe, Malawi.

Without providing any evidence, the former president claimed that Chakwera has travelled overseas 34 times and that the current president recently travelled to Egypt with more than 250 people, which should have cost the country a fortune given that the country cannot import fuel.

"People are sleeping in pump stations while the president drives by on his way to golf," Mutharika explained.

All of these accusations were made by the former while speaking to members of the media at his Page house in Mangochi on Friday.

Mutharika also urged Chakwera to make AIP fertilizer available in the country by December.
